FIXTURE MODE "Standard"

Color mixing
The

A12 features a colour wheel channel, RGBW colour mixing channels and a CTC

channel.

The colour wheel channel has priority. Only if the colour wheel channel is set to

DMX

value 000-001 it is possible to operate the RGB channels. (In Extended mode E8

at

DMX value 001 all LED rings are adapted to the color of the inner ring (A)).

The

CTC channel can be combined with both the RGBW channels and the colour wheel

channel.

Control channel 5
The

control channel (channel 5) offers additional control over the RGBW-channels. It is

useful

to adjust the white balance when units are being used in rental business and a

variety

of fixtures are supposed to offer a even colour mixing.

DMX

000-007: No white balance active.

DMX

008-015: Basic adjustment on the RGBW channels. So it‘s possible to have

always the same white from different production series (factory adjustment). Marginal

reduced intensity of the RGBW strings.
DMX

016-023: White balance to 5600K. Reduced intensity in blue. Possible reduction in

intensity of green and red. If fixtures are set to this DMX value the white of fixed colors

and RGBW color mixing is the same, it‘s a white similar to HMI white.
DMX

024-031: White balance same to DMX 016-023. Plus the RGBW curves are

working in linear mode so it is possible to use the color picker function of various

lighting control desks.

Some lighting desks have a delay during DMX refreshing and DMX values get missed

during a fade out or using the fader. That means the A12 with his fast reaction time rate

this happen as a shutter and shows flickering in the beam. To avoid this you can select

5 different modes. Depending on the modus, the reaction time of the A12 gets lower.
